We’ve all been hearing online the best baby names of 2011, haven’t we? How about time we bring you guys all a little treat by showing the ten most controversial celebrity baby names, ever!

1. Tu Morrow

2. Moxie Crimefighter

3. Pilot Inspektor

4. FiFi Trixiebell

5. Audio Science

6. JermaJesty

7.  Sage Moonblood

8. Speck Wildhorse

9. Mars Merkaba

10. Buddy Bear

